The FJ Bruisers will be gathering in the George Washington National Forest for their third annual Spring MudFling on Memorial Day weekend (5/23-5/25). MudFling is the major wheeling and camping event on the Bruisers calendar, and 2009 will be the biggest yet!
They have a bunch of generous sponsors who are donating swag for the raffle and BBQ. Sponsors include Sierra Expeditions, Lucrum, Elemmats, FJC Magazine and many more!
They will be running in the North River (Dry River) area, which includes the Salt Shed, 2nd Mountain, Flag Pole, Kephart and Dictum Ridge to name a few… This section is west of Harrisonburg, Virginia on Route 33.
The Bruisers have been scouting all spring to ensure that they’re able to map out the most fun, challenging and legal routes to wheel - offering something for everyone, from bone stock to heavily modded.
